Section D: Higher-Order Thinking and Expression (Questions 16–20)

Question 16 (1 mark)
Answer: 画龙点睛 (huà lóng diǎn jīng)
Sample sentence: 老师在我的作文结尾加了一句话,真是画龙点睛,让整篇文章更加生动了。

Marking notes: Award 1 mark for the correct character "睛" AND a grammatically correct sentence using the idiom appropriately. Half credit (0 marks) if only the character is given without a sentence.


Question 17 (1 mark)
Model answer:
有些学生平时不复习,考试前才临时抱佛脚,希望能猜中题目。这种做法就像守株待兔一样,不努力却想得到好成绩,是不可靠的。

Marking notes: Award 1 mark for using the idiom correctly in a context that shows understanding of its meaning (passive waiting without effort). Accept any reasonable student-related scenario.


Question 18 (1 mark)
Translation: 学习却不思考,就会感到迷茫。
Meaning: 这句话告诉我们,学习必须和思考结合起来,否则就无法真正理解知识。

Marking notes: Award 1 mark for a correct translation AND a meaningful explanation. The phrase is from Confucius's Analects (论语·为政). Accept minor variations in translation as long as the core meaning is captured.


Question 19 (1 mark)
Model answer:
"凝视"带有深情、专注的感情色彩,通常用于看重要的人或事物,比如"凝视着远方的山峰"。"注视"比较中性,只是表示集中注意力看,比如"注视着黑板上的字"。

Marking notes: Award 1 mark for correctly distinguishing the emotional nuance between the two words. The key difference: 凝视 = deep, emotional gaze; 注视 = neutral, attentive looking.


Question 20 (1 mark)
Sample sentence:
学习高级华文不但能让我掌握更丰富的词汇,而且能让我更深入地了解中华文化,甚至能帮助我在未来的学习和工作中更具竞争力。

Marking notes: Award 1 mark for correct use of the "不但……而且……甚至……" structure with three logically connected clauses. The clauses should show increasing depth or scope.
